.32 Colt New Police IS .32 S&W Long.   Colt did not want to put their competitors name on their guns, so they renamed the cartridge instead.   They did the same thing with .38 S&W, calling it .38 New Colt Police.   The only difference in the .38 rounds is that the S&W one was a 146 grain round nose bullet, and the Colt round was a 145 RNFP bullet.   Brass was identical.   I assume similar differences for .32 S&W and .32 New Colt Police.
